fast converting Bitmap to BitmapSource wpf


I need to draw an image on the Image component at 30Hz. I use this code :

public MainWindow()
    {
        InitializeComponent();

        Messenger.Default.Register<Bitmap>(this, (bmp) =>
        {
            ImageTarget.Dispatcher.BeginInvoke((Action)(() =>
            {
                var hBitmap = bmp.GetHbitmap();
                var drawable = System.Windows.Interop.Imaging.CreateBitmapSourceFromHBitmap(
                  hBitmap,
                  IntPtr.Zero,
                  Int32Rect.Empty,
                  BitmapSizeOptions.FromEmptyOptions());
                DeleteObject(hBitmap);
                ImageTarget.Source = drawable;
            }));
        });
    }

The problem is, with this code, My CPU usage is about 80%, and, without the convertion it's about 6%.

So why converting bitmap is so long ?
Are there faster method (with unsafe code) ?


Solution

  • Here is a method that (to my experience) is at least four times faster than CreateBitmapSourceFromHBitmap.

    It requires that you set the correct PixelFormat of the resulting BitmapSource.

    public static BitmapSource Convert(System.Drawing.Bitmap bitmap)
    {
        var bitmapData = bitmap.LockBits(
            new System.Drawing.Rectangle(0, 0, bitmap.Width, bitmap.Height),
            System.Drawing.Imaging.ImageLockMode.ReadOnly, bitmap.PixelFormat);
    
        var bitmapSource = BitmapSource.Create(
            bitmapData.Width, bitmapData.Height,
            bitmap.HorizontalResolution, bitmap.VerticalResolution,
            PixelFormats.Bgr24, null,
            bitmapData.Scan0, bitmapData.Stride * bitmapData.Height, bitmapData.Stride);
    
        bitmap.UnlockBits(bitmapData);
    
        return bitmapSource;
    }
